Bio

Seventh-year head coach Josh George has built a strong program in one of the most competitive soccer conferences in the state of Indiana. In a short time George has turned the Bulldogs into a perennial top ten team in IHSAA Class 3A and a threat to advance deep in the state tournament.

Brownsburg clinched a second consecutive IHSAA Sectional championship in 2021 as the Bulldogs won over Plainfield in thrilling fashion. The 1-0 double-overtime victory avenged a regular season loss to the Quakers and sent the Bulldogs to the IHSAA Regional for the second straight season. Brownsburg hosted the IHSAA Regional Semi-final at Our Pitch, posting a tough effort in a 2-0 loss to eventual IHSAA Stare

The Bulldogs made history in 2020 under George as Brownsburg won its first IHSAA Sectional championship since 2012. The 3-1 overtime win over Avon avenged five consecutive postseason losses to the Orioles and put Brownsburg in the IHSAA Regional against eventual IHSAA State finalist Guerin Catholic.

He won his 50th game at the helm of the program in 2020 and was selected as ISCA District Coach of the Year. Seniors Abby Lynch and Grace Crawford were named ISCA All-State selections following the season. It marked the first time since at least 2011 that the program has received multiple ISCA All-State selections.

2020 was the culmination of several successful seasons under George, who has guided Brownsburg to five consecutive winning seasons and a 53-29-10 record in his tenure. This success comes after the program went through a five-year drought without a winning season. Under George's guidance, the Bulldogs have advanced in the state tournament during five of George's six years as the coach.

George quickly turned around the program when he first took over in 2016.

During his inaugural campaign the Bulldogs' 8-6-4 record was their first winning mark since 2010. They advanced to the Sectional semi-final for the first time since 2015 and doubled their win total from the previous year. What followed was back to back 12-5-1 marks in 2017 and 2018. The 2017 Bulldogs were the first to amass double-digit wins since 2012. The 2018 Bulldogs finished the year ranked No.11 in Class 3A and third in the Hoosier Crossroads Conference standings.

George has coached several Bulldogs to the next level as well as numerous All-HCC, ISCA All-State, ISCA All-District and ICSA Academic All-District selections.

In his nearly 20 years of coaching experience, George has held positions at the club, high school and collegiate levels.

George has worked both as a coach and a Director of Coaching for Westside United FC, a Premier level soccer club based out of Avon, IN since joining the program in 2002.

He started as a coach for the club where George has led over half a dozen teams to high levels of success. He has been a part of 11 State Championships, 3 State Finalists, 5 State Semi-Finals, 3 Regional Semi-Finals and 1 Regional Final in his time with the club.

In 2007, George was added as the Director of Coaching for WSU.

George worked as a Volunteer Assistant in 2002 for the Men’s Soccer program at the University of Indianapolis, his alma mater. He attended UIndy from 2002-2006 where he was a member of the Men’s soccer team. He earned four letters and was a part of the program's second-ever stretch of consecutive winning seasons. As a senior, he played in all but one of the team's matches.

George graduated from UIndy with a degree in Elementary Education.

Prior to his career at UIndy, George played nearby at Danville High School from 1998-2002. He was a three-year team captain and All-conference selection with the Warriors. George graduated from Danville as the school's all-time leader in assists and was awarded the "Team MVP" his senior season.

George is married to his wife, Rachel, and has two daughters, Chloe and Isabella.
